Frequently Asked Questions about South Dartmouth
What is the current price range for One Bedroom South Dartmouth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in South Dartmouth ranges from $1,595 to $2,275 with an average monthly rent of $1,894.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in South Dartmouth c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in South Dartmouth range from $2,145 to $3,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,626.
